Personality/ Celebrity / Famous Name: Edmond de Goncourt

Edmond de Goncourt (May 26, 1822 – July 16, 1896) was a French writer, critic, book publisher and the founder of the Académie Goncourt.

Personality/ Celebrity / Famous Name: Edmond Benjamin James de Rothschild

Edmond Benjamin James de Rothschild (August 19, 1845 - November 2, 1934) was a philanthropist and activist for Jewish affairs and a member of the prominent Rothschild family.

Personality/ Celebrity / Famous Name: Edmond O'Brien

Edmond O'Brien (September 10, 1915 – May 9, 1985) was an Academy Award-winning American film actor who is perhaps best remembered for his role in D.O.A. (1950).

Personality/ Celebrity / Famous Name: Edmond Halley

Edmond Halley (November 8, 1656 – January 14, 1742) was an English astronomer, geophysicist, mathematician, meteorologist, and physicist.

Edmond Richer     Edmond Richer       Origin/Culture/Country: French

Edmond Richer: was a French theologian known for several works advocating the Gallican theory that the Pope's power was limited by authority of bishops, and by temporal governments. In his Historia Conciliorum Generalium as with other works, Richer elaborated upon and defended Gallicanism, an early theory that described the limits of papal power, and provided one of the early constructs of what later evolved to be the modern concept of "separation of church and state", an important theme in the political history of the United States. Richer's explanation and defense of the theory and practice of Gallicanism was an expression of French resistance to the power and reach of the Pope during that period.[1]

Edmond Auger     Edmond Auger       Origin/Culture/Country: French

Edmond Auger: was a French Jesuit. Later he was in Lyons, during a pestilence, devoting himself to the plague-stricken. When the pest had ceased, in consequence of a vow he made, the authorities, in gratitude, established a college of the Society to which Auger asked much to their astonishment, that the children of the Calvinists might be admitted. His whole life was one of constant activity, preaching and administering the responsible offices of Provincial, Rector etc., that were entrusted to him.

Edmond Nicolas Laguerre     Edmond Nicolas Laguerre       Origin/Culture/Country: French

Edmond Nicolas Laguerre: was a French mathematician, a member of the Académie française (1885). His main works were in the areas of geometry and complex analysis. He also investigated orthogonal polynomials (see Laguerre polynomials). Laguerre's method is a root-finding algorithm tailored to polynomials, named after him.
